    Nigerian Cambridge-trained lady visits 10 countries in three weeks

    A Nigerian Cambridge-trained lady, who travelled to 10 countries within three weeks, spent £3,000 (N6 million).

    Nkpouto Pius, said armed with her Nigerian passport, she took off from Lagos to the 10 countries.

    The adventurous lady, @MkpoutoPius, said she recently embarked on a solo trip to 10 countries in three weeks without the help of any travel agent.

    @MkpoutoPius said she used her Nigerian passport and the entire trip cost her £3,000 (N6 million).

    @MkpoutoPius revealed she applied for a Schengen visa in Lagos herself, which allowed her to enter European countries.

    She took off from Lagos, Nigeria, and visited such countries as Senegal, Cape Verde, Portugal, Spain, Italy, Vatican City, Greece, Germany, Switzerland, and Uganda.

    While that it was a solo trip, @MkpoutoPius shared what she did in the countries she visited. “…I made a list of the top tourist attractions in each city and made sure to visit them. I only retired to my accommodation at night to sleep.”

    Her words, “I arranged this entire trip by myself. NO TRAVEL ANGENT. “I applied for my Schengen visa in Lagos by myself.

    “I took a map of the world and traced my steps from country to country; then I proceeded to start booking the flights and accommodation by myself.”
